A care recruitment agency in Ballymena is seeking compassionate Care Assistants to support elderly residents in care homes. You will assist with personal care and daily routines, ensuring a safe environment.

Opportunities for full-time and part-time shifts are available, with pay rates ranging from £13.50 to £17.50 per hour. Previous experience in healthcare is necessary, along with a commitment to training and compliance.

Join a supportive team dedicated to high-quality care.

How to prepare for a job interview at First Choice Rec

Know Your Stuff

Before the interview, brush up on your knowledge of elderly care and the specific needs of residents in care homes. Familiarise yourself with common personal care tasks and daily routines, as well as any relevant regulations or compliance standards.

Show Your Compassion

During the interview, be sure to convey your genuine passion for helping others. Share personal anecdotes or experiences that highlight your compassionate nature and commitment to providing high-quality care.

Ask Thoughtful Questions

Prepare a few insightful questions about the role and the team you'll be working with. This shows your interest in the position and helps you understand the agency's values and approach to care.

Dress for Success

Even though this is a care role, first impressions matter! Dress smartly and professionally for your interview. It reflects your seriousness about the position and respect for the care environment.
